of Diatipt Works, North Circular Road, Cricklewood, London N.W.2. Also, of Basingstoke.
1947 Private company.
1955 Company made public.
1961 Merchants of industrial and common quality diamonds and manufacturers of diamond powder and diamond tools. [1]
1969 Acquired by Universal Grinding[2]
1972 Van Moppes received support for a project on a profile grinder from government programme for the machine tool industry [3]
1972 One of 2 companies in the Diamond Products Division of Universal Grinding[4]
Universal Grinding became Unicorn Industries
By 2000 was a Saint-Gobain company[5]
